The Current State of Major Cryptocurrencies: A Critical Analysis

The cryptocurrency market is known for its volatility, and recent events have pushed this characteristic into sharp relief. As we delve deeper into the dynamics of Ethereum, Ripple, Cardano, Binance Coin, and Solana, it becomes clear that the landscape is fraught with challenges. After a savage crash on Monday, many coins experienced sharp dips that highlighted investors’ fears and market uncertainties. This article aims to provide an insightful commentary on the aforementioned cryptocurrencies and explore potential future movements.

Ethereum started the week on a disastrous note, plummeting to $2,100 before trying to mount a recovery, closing the week around $2,700. This represents a staggering 16% decrease, and despite its efforts to reclaim the $3,000 mark, it has faced notably stiff resistance. The technical indicators suggest a bearish trend, especially after Ethereum’s MACD demonstrated a bearish cross on the weekly chart. Such signals often indicate a prevailing downward momentum.

The market’s fear is palpable, as reflected by the skyrocketing selling volume, illustrating a lack of buyer conviction. With critical support residing at $2,400, the demand from buyers is essential to stave off a looming drop below $2,000. Should this support be breached, it could trigger a cascade of sell-offs, creating deeper fractures in investor confidence.

XRP mirrored Ethereum’s tumultuous ride, witnessing a brief rally that fizzled out on Monday, precipitating a fall to $1.8. Although buyers stepped in to push the price back toward $2.3, the overall sentiment for XRP leans bearish following a significant loss of 24% over the course of the week. The market seems to be undergoing a major correction, which could play out over an extended period.

For investors who took positions above $3, this drastic reversal poses a steep financial burden, as the potential for further declines looms. Key support levels now rest at $2 and $1.6, which could become critical should bearish sentiment intensify. With buyers showing interest during minor dips, their resolve will soon be tested. A lengthy market digestion period will be paramount for trend reversal.

Cardano’s price action followed a similar downward trajectory, suffering a steep decline to $0.5 on Monday. Close on recovery, Cardano ended the week with a notable loss of 21%. A conjecture of continued bearish momentum prevails, given the downtrend and technical signals that suggest support at $0.64 could merely serve as a temporary halt in what may be a more profound descent.

In a market dominated by bearish sentiment, the likelihood of revisiting $0.5 remains high if $0.64 fails to hold. Cardano’s ongoing correction could be indicative of broader market sentiments, demanding vigilant monitoring by investors who aspire to reenter at more favorable price points.

Binance Coin (BNB) displayed a mixture of resilience and vulnerability. After drifting down to $500—an ominous price point not seen since September 2024—BNB faced rigorous attempts to stay afloat above the $600 threshold, ultimately closing with a 15% weekly loss. The vital support levels are now evident at $550 and $500, which may come into play should buyer interest linger at these price points.

For BNB to reclaim its upward trajectory, it must first overcome resistance at $600. Investors are left to ponder the token’s fortitude: whether it will hold above $500 to mean-revert or falter further during these uncertain times in the market.

Solana’s price action has not been exempt from the turmoil either, dropping below the critical $200 level. An initial attempt to rally proved futile, culminating in a 19% weekly loss that saw it settle at approximately $190. In the wake of this decline, the market has established $200 as a formidable line of resistance, while a critical support zone has emerged around $164.

Technical indicators, including descending MACD and RSI values, highlight Solana as firmly in the hands of sellers, foreshadowing a potentially protracted period under present pressures. Looking to the future, a reversal could emerge within the support corridor of $164 to $134, but this will necessitate a significant shift in market sentiment to materialize.

The overarching narrative in the cryptocurrency market currently paints a picture of caution and restraint. For Ethereum, XRP, Cardano, BNB, and Solana, the immediate landscape reflects significant bearish tendencies, marked by wide-ranging declines. As each cryptocurrency grapples with its unique challenges, investors remain watchful—ready to adapt strategies based on evolving market conditions. The next steps for these digital assets will depend heavily on maintaining crucial support levels and reviving buyer interest, all while navigating the volatile waters of speculative trading.
